The Rodeo wall is a great wall for moderate climbs that offer some of the best patina in the Jackson area. Just 2 miles South from Hoback Junction you can’t miss the large pullout with the impressive little East acing rock face. A short 10 minute hike and you are at the wall. One of the best routes on the wall Alive in Wyoming is also a great warm up. The large overhang that runs the full length of the wall makes for some fun climbing.
